Transaction 7eeb66f058578ba205c878772cd2a7a867909d8d986fef1486a204d4aef9a130

1 Input
2 Outputs
  • 7eeb66f058578ba205c878772cd2a7a867909d8d986fef1486a204d4aef9a130:0
  • value  4223119
    address  33Ky3aQmsCzzbK5ZTg1pk1wfMf7QFR5yXx
  • 7eeb66f058578ba205c878772cd2a7a867909d8d986fef1486a204d4aef9a130:1
  • value  14533330
    address  1DkUp8zpueZs6vGXgfh5fr5JqpVTrJtqYZ